Painting Description
"View of Keizersgracht, Corner of Reguliersgracht" is a painting by the Dutch artist George Hendrik Breitner, known for his realistic and dynamic depictions of urban life. Breitner, a prominent figure in the Amsterdam Impressionism movement, often captured the bustling streets and canals of Amsterdam, reflecting the energy and atmosphere of the city during the late 19th and early 20th centuries.
This particular painting showcases the intersection of two iconic canals in Amsterdam: the Keizersgracht and the Reguliersgracht. Breitner's work is characterized by its loose brushwork and attention to the effects of light and weather, which can be seen in this piece. The painting likely captures a moment in time, with an emphasis on the movement and life of the city, possibly featuring pedestrians, carriages, or boats typical of the era.
Breitner's approach often involved photographing scenes before painting them, allowing him to study the composition and details meticulously. This method contributed to the authenticity and vibrancy of his urban landscapes. His works are considered important in documenting the transformation of Amsterdam during a period of rapid modernization.
The painting is part of a broader body of work by Breitner that focuses on Amsterdam's architecture and daily life, offering a glimpse into the historical and cultural context of the time. His ability to convey the mood and essence of the city has made his paintings valuable both artistically and historically.
Breitner's influence extends beyond his paintings, as he played a significant role in the development of Dutch Impressionism, inspiring future generations of artists. His works are held in high regard and are featured in various museums and collections, contributing to the appreciation of Amsterdam's rich artistic heritage.
